Responsibilities

What you’ll do

  • Goes above and beyond to deliver an exceptional client and customer experience that is guided by the SP+ Promise, including answering questions, offering city directions, and ensuring each customer interaction is a positive experience.
  • Performing vehicle inspections, maintaining cleanliness of bus interiors, fueling of buses, logging trip counts and assisting disabled passengers. 
  • Responsible for being at work every scheduled day, on time and in uniform. 
  • Possess a valid state-issued driver’s license to be carried with driver, at all times, while on duty. 
  • Have and maintain an acceptable DMV record. 
  • Report any known accidents, observed or suspected violations of Company policy, safety hazards or any unusual occurrence to the Facility Manager. 
  • Communicate debris, water, oil spills and etc. to garage office. 
  • Substitute for Cashiers or Valets, when necessary, if authorized. 
  • Have a thorough knowledge of all areas of the garage, thorough knowledge of the major streets, landmarks and freeways in the area of the garage to assist customers in a seamless transportation experience.
  • Assisting customers with luggage and other traveling items, if applicable (e.g. operating shuttle buses at an airport location). 
  • Assist Facility Manager with other duties as needed.

What you need

 

Qualification Requirements: To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ily.  The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. 

 

Education/Experience Required: Less than High School education or one month related experience, training or an equivalent combination of education and experience. 

 

License Requirement:  Per DOT Regulations, you will be required to have and maintain a valid CDL Class A, B or C Driver’s License with Passenger Endorsement.

 

DOT Medical Card: A Medical Examiner’s Certificate (DOT Medical Card) is required.

 

Availability to Work:  Special shift requirements, if any, will vary depending on a location's hiring needs.  If applicable, availability to work 3rd shift and/or week-ends may be a requirement.

 

Language Skills: Ability to read and comprehend simple instructions, short correspondence, and memos.  Ability to write simple correspondence.  Ability to effectively present information in one-on-one situations to customers and other employees of the company.
